在共享经济不断深化、智慧交通体系加速构建的今天,约车源码开发已不再局限于简单的功能堆砌与代码实现,而是逐步演变为支撑智能出行生态的核心技术引擎。随着用户对出行效率、服务体验和系统稳定性的要求日益提高,传统的约车系统架构逐渐暴露出响应延迟高、模块间协作不畅、扩展性差等痛点。尤其是在高峰时段,订单调度混乱、司机接单不及时、乘客等待时间过长等问题频发,严重影响了平台的口碑与用户留存。究其根本,问题不仅出在算法层面,更在于系统内部各组件之间的协同机制薄弱。因此,如何通过“协同技术”重构约车系统的底层逻辑,成为决定平台能否持续发展的关键。
协同技术:从数据同步到智能联动的跃迁
所谓协同技术,在约车系统中并不仅仅是消息传递或接口调用那么简单。它是一种贯穿于司机端、乘客端、调度中心与第三方服务(如支付网关、地图定位、保险服务)之间的高效联动机制。真正意义上的协同,意味着系统能够在毫秒级内完成状态同步、任务分发与异常处理,确保每一个环节都处于实时可见、可控的状态。例如,当乘客发起一个订单请求时,系统不仅要快速匹配附近司机,还需同时触发位置更新、路线规划、预估费用计算、支付通道准备等多个子流程,并在多个终端之间保持一致的状态视图。若缺乏有效的协同机制,这些操作可能因异步阻塞而产生延迟,甚至导致重复派单或信息错乱。
当前市场上多数约车平台仍采用集中式架构,依赖单一数据库和同步调用链路,一旦核心节点出现瓶颈,整个系统便容易陷入雪崩。而引入基于消息队列(如Kafka、RabbitMQ)的异步通信模式,配合微服务间的事件驱动机制,能够有效解耦各业务模块,使系统具备更高的容错能力与弹性伸缩性。这种架构下,调度中心发出“可接单”事件后,司机端、地图服务、支付系统等均可独立订阅并响应,无需等待主流程完成,极大提升了整体响应速度。

分布式协同框架:构建高可用的智能调度底座
为了应对百万级并发请求的挑战,约车源码开发必须向分布式协同框架演进。该框架的核心目标是实现多端状态的一致性、动态负载均衡以及故障下的快速恢复。通过引入分布式缓存(如Redis Cluster)、一致性哈希算法和全局唯一ID生成机制,系统可以在不同区域节点间实现数据的高效同步,避免因地域差异造成的资源错配。同时,结合服务网格(Service Mesh)技术,可以对每个微服务的调用链进行精细化监控与治理,及时发现并隔离异常服务,保障核心流程不受影响。
此外,边缘计算的引入为降低延迟提供了新思路。将部分调度逻辑下沉至靠近用户的本地边缘节点,比如城市级边缘服务器或运营商基站,可以让订单匹配过程摆脱中心化数据中心的限制,实现“本地感知、就近响应”。例如,在交通枢纽或大型商圈周边部署边缘节点,可在100毫秒内完成司机与乘客的精准匹配,显著改善用户体验。这一策略尤其适用于高频短途出行场景,能有效缓解主控中心的压力,提升系统的整体吞吐量。
落地实施中的挑战与破局之道
尽管协同技术前景广阔,但在实际落地过程中仍面临诸多挑战。首先是技术整合难度大,不同团队使用的开发语言、数据格式、通信协议各异,导致接口对接成本高昂;其次是跨部门协作效率低,开发、测试、运维之间存在信息断层,难以形成高效的迭代节奏。对此,建议从以下三个方面入手:第一,制定统一的API规范与数据契约标准,使用OpenAPI或gRPC定义清晰的服务接口,减少沟通成本;第二,采用容器化部署(如Docker + Kubernetes),确保开发、测试、生产环境的一致性,避免“在我机器上能跑”的尴尬;第三,推行敏捷开发模式,以两周为一个迭代周期,持续交付可用版本,通过快速反馈不断优化系统性能。
值得一提的是,许多中小型平台在初期往往忽视了协同架构的重要性,仅追求功能上线速度,结果后期维护困难、扩展受限。而真正具备长期竞争力的平台,往往在早期就投入资源搭建可扩展的协同基础。这不仅是技术选择,更是一种战略远见。
未来展望:迈向可持续的智慧出行生态
长远来看,以协同技术为核心的约车源码开发,将推动整个出行行业的数字化转型。当系统具备自适应调度、多模态融合、跨平台协同的能力后,不仅可以支持网约车、顺风车、电动自行车等多种出行方式的统一管理,还能与城市交通大脑深度对接,实现红绿灯调控、拥堵预警、公交优先等智能化应用。未来的智慧出行生态,不再是孤立的打车平台,而是一个开放、共享、动态优化的城市交通网络。
对于有志于打造自有出行品牌的创业者或企业而言,掌握协同技术的底层逻辑,意味着拥有了构建差异化竞争优势的关键武器。无论是提升订单转化率、降低运营成本,还是增强用户粘性,协同技术都是不可或缺的基础设施。
我们专注于约车源码开发领域多年,积累了丰富的实战经验,能够为客户提供从需求分析、架构设计到系统部署的一站式解决方案,尤其擅长基于分布式协同框架与边缘计算的高性能系统构建,确保平台在高并发场景下的稳定运行与极致体验,助力客户快速抢占市场先机,17723342546